What is hex #3E563D Color?

Gray-Asparagus (Hex code: 3E563D) Thumbnail

The color name of hex code #3E563D is Gray-Asparagus. The RGB values are (62, 86, 61) which means it is composed of 30% red, 41% green and 29% blue. The CMYK color codes, used in printers, are C:28 M:0 Y:29 K:66. In the HSV/HSB scale, #3E563D has a hue of 118°, 29% saturation and a brightness value of 34%.

Complementary Palette

The complement of #3E563D is #553D56 which is called English Violet. Complementary colors are those found at the opposite ends of the color wheel. Thus, as per the RGB system, the best contrast to #3E563D color is offered by #553D56. The complementary color palette is easiest to use and work with. Studies have shown that contrasting color palette is the best way to grab a viewer's attention.

Split-Complementary Palette

As per the RGB color wheel, the split-complementary colors of #3E563D are #493D56 (Purple Taupe) and #563D4B (Purple Taupe). A split-complementary color palette consists of the main color along with those on either side (30°) of the complementary color. Based on our research, usage of split-complementary palettes is on the rise online, especially in graphics and web sites designs. It may be because it is not as contrasting as the complementary color palette and, hence, results in a combination which is pleasant to the eyes.

Triadic Palette

#3E563D triadic color palette has three colors each of which is separated by 120° in the RGB wheel. Thus, #3D3E56 (Charcoal) and #563D3E (Liver Chestnut (Horses)) along with #3E563D, our main color, create a stunning and beautiful triadic palette with the maximum variation in hue and, therefore, offering the best possible contrast when taken together.
